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
104054622 41 992 88
5688 460
5688 460
26973 4856998285 2645186046 60 91
All about undefined
Interested in learning more?
5688 460
26973 4856998285 2645186046 60 91
See more
90770313 814478
4075637 7824305 40098
See more
39045530 4535967753
54 5829091 1814981
See more